The Human Genome and MEDLINE are both the foci of intense data- mining efforts worldwide. The biomedical literature has much to say about sequence, but it also seems that sequence can tell us much about the biomedical literature. Biological natural language processing is an emerging field of research that seeks to explore systematically the relationships between genes, sequences and the biomedical literature as a basis for a new generation of data- mining tools.
